Why Small-Batch Synthetic Yarn Producers Are Rethinking Packaging Automation

Historically, packaging automation was reserved for high-volume textile mills running continuous rolls of polyester or nylon filament. But today’s market demands agility: limited-edition sportswear lines, performance-fabric prototypes, and regional compliance-driven batches (e.g., EU REACH-compliant spools) require packaging systems that scale down—not up. Over 68% of mid-tier textile converters now process orders under 500 kg per SKU per month, yet 92% still rely on manual or semi-automated packing stations with >15-minute changeover times.

This misalignment creates three critical bottlenecks: inconsistent labeling (especially for dual-language or eco-certified tags), higher labor cost per unit (up to 3.2× vs. automated batch runs), and delayed shipment windows due to manual verification steps. For distributors and agents handling multi-brand portfolios—including technical yarns for medical textiles or flame-retardant blends—the risk of non-compliant packaging increases by 40% when relying on legacy workflows.

The shift is no longer about throughput alone—it’s about precision, traceability, and regulatory readiness. Modern small-batch packaging automation integrates inline weight verification (±0.3 g tolerance), dynamic label printing (GS1-128, QR-coded batch IDs), and modular format change kits deployable in under 7 minutes. How to Evaluate Automation Fit for Your Batch Profile

Key Procurement Dimensions for Small-Batch Yarns

Procurement and sourcing teams must move beyond “machine speed” metrics. Instead, prioritize these five evaluation criteria:

  • Changeover time: ≤7 minutes for new spool diameter (e.g., 150 mm → 400 mm) and label template
  • Minimum viable batch size: Verified operation at 25–50 units without recalibration
  • ESG-integrated controls: Built-in audit trail for recyclable film usage, ink VOC levels, and carbon footprint per pack
  • Integration latency: API-ready connection to ERP (SAP S/4HANA, Oracle Cloud SCM) within ≤48 hours of deployment
  • Service SLA: On-site technician response <24 hrs for critical faults; remote diagnostics enabled within 1 hour

These parameters reflect real-world constraints faced by global buyers—especially those managing cross-border distribution of specialty synthetics. A 2023 GSR benchmark across 47 Tier-2 yarn converters showed that systems meeting all five criteria reduced average order-to-ship cycle time from 5.8 days to 2.3 days—and cut packaging-related customer complaints by 61%.

Packaging Automation: Mass-Roll vs. Small-Batch Systems Compared

Selecting the right system hinges on understanding structural trade-offs—not just price. Below is a comparative analysis based on verified deployments tracked by GSR’s supply chain intelligence network across 12 countries.

Feature Mass-Roll Dedicated System Modular Small-Batch Platform
Typical minimum batch size ≥5,000 units 25–200 units
Label format flexibility Fixed die-cut only; 3-week lead time for new templates Digital print-on-demand; editable via web UI in <5 mins
Certification support ISO 9001 only; no ESG reporting module Pre-loaded modules for EU Eco-Label, GRS, Oeko-Tex Standard 100

This comparison reveals why over 73% of procurement directors evaluating automation for synthetic yarns now shortlist modular platforms—even when their largest SKU moves only 300 units/month. The ROI isn’t in speed alone; it’s in eliminating rework, accelerating compliance sign-off, and enabling faster SKU proliferation without infrastructure lock-in.
